At what point does Xfinity report late payments to credit reporting agencies like Experian and Expedia?

I missed one month, then was a few days late on the next month which included the previous balance. I'm concerned it may impact my FICO score.

Hey there, @user_7ed5bd. Great question! Xfinity does not report late payments to credit reporting agencies like Experian or TransUnion. Instead, when a customer's account is hard disconnected due to unpaid balances, the account is sent to an Outside Collection Agency (OCA), which may report the debt to the major credit bureaus. Customers should contact the OCA directly for any disputes regarding charges or credit reporting questions, as Xfinity will not provide this information.
